NCES history for this school begins in 1988. Race categories changed by 2010: earlier data combines Asian and Pacific Islander students and does not consistently identify multiracial students. The chart retains that history, while the change table uses 2010 onward.

What school district is Martin Middle in?

Martin Middle is part of the Austin ISD district in Austin, Texas.

Is Martin Middle a good school?

SchoolRow ranks Martin Middle 1,691st of 1,701 Texas middle schools (better than 1%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(STAAR % at Meets Grade Level or above, 2024–25 (TAPR)).

What is the racial makeup of Martin Middle?

Hispanic 85%, Black 12%, Asian 2%, White 2% (240 students, 2023–24).
